CBP Issues Final Rule on Quarterly HMF
U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) has published in the November 24, 2009 edition of the Federal Register a final rule with regard to harbor maintenance fees (HMF).
The final rule amends part 19 of the Code of Federal Regulations (10 CFR) to establish an option for payers of quarterly HMF to submit payments or refund requests online. CBP will still accept payments or refund requests by mail.
The rule also clarifies that both payments and refund requests must be accompanied by CBP Forms 350 (HMF Amended Quarterly Summary Report) and 349 (HMF Quarterly Summary Report).
According to the rule, the changes are "intended to provide the trade with expanded electronic payment/refund options and to modernize and enhance CBP's port use fee collection efforts."
The final rule becomes effective December 24, 2009.
